[015/105] eCryptfs: Unlock page in write_begin error path

commit 50f198ae16ac66508d4b8d5a40967a8507ad19ee upstream.

Unlock the page in error path of ecryptfs_write_begin(). This may
happen, for example, if decryption fails while bring the page
up-to-date.

Signed-off-by: Tyler Hicks <tyhicks@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x>
Signed-off-by: Greg Kroah-Hartman <gregkh@xxxxxxx>

---
fs/ecryptfs/mmap.c | 5 +++++
1 file changed, 5 insertions(+)

--- a/fs/ecryptfs/mmap.c
+++ b/fs/ecryptfs/mmap.c
@@ -374,6 +374,11 @@ static int ecryptfs_write_begin(struct f
&& (pos != 0))
zero_user(page, 0, PAGE_CACHE_SIZE);
out:
+ if (unlikely(rc)) {
+ unlock_page(page);
+ page_cache_release(page);
+ *pagep = NULL;
+ }
return rc;
}
